MSU Student Elected to FFA National Office
MSU student Alexandria Henry was recently named the National FFA Eastern Region Vice President for 2009–2010. FFA is an agricultural organization; its mission is to make “a positive difference in the lives of students by developing their potential for premier leadership, personal growth and career success through agricultural education.” Henry is studying agricultural education and communications, so she is the perfect fit to represent the FFA by traveling around the world and spreading its message.
